Seems the WM at Beehive Mail has started making people do sign ups before paying even though that is not required according to the TOS.
It used to pay very quickly upon reaching payout but now unless you are doing the sign ups she has gone past the 30 day time period that the TOS promise you will be paid in.
I would definitely stay away from this site. Things are looking questionable as to whether you can count on being paid here.
